Benefits and challenges of moving into senior apartments

Senior apartments involve a wide variety of options, from independent living apartments to houses on rent or for sale and from seniors assisted living to hospitals and nursing homes for those who require daily medical help.

Overview

These apartments are specifically made for senior citizens and follow a strict age restriction for 55 or 62+. These apartments include features that are senior-friendly such as activities, amenities, and more. Personal and medical care are not always provided with these apartments; however, in few cases, meals, housekeeping, and several other services can be purchased additionally.

Benefits of residing in senior apartments

The ability to live around people your own age, without the need to share the same house or room, is one of the biggest benefits of senior apartments. Its provides you with opportunities to make new friends and keep you engaged in several community activities.
If you compare the maintenance requirements of a house to an apartment, an apartment would require much less maintenance and hence the monthly expenses would be low.
Finally, senior apartments are often located near hospitals and nursing homes and hence is much more safe and reliable in terms of a medical emergency.

Challenges faced when moving into senior apartments

It can be an immensely emotional experience to leave your house, which is full of memories, and move into a enior apartment. This difficult and emotional move is considered as one of the major downsides of moving into senior apartments.
When moving from a house to a comparatively smaller apartment, you may be required to sell or leave behind several furniture items, assets, and belongings as you may not be able to fit them all in your apartment.
You must also keep in mind that most senior apartments offer no typical on-site medical and health services.
